NYU-Affiliated Aliviado Lands $6.1M for Hospice Dementia Care

Aliviado Health, an initiative run out of the Hartford Institute for Geriatric Nursing at New York University’s Rory Meyers College of Nursing, has landed $6.1 million to study how hospice patients can benefit from effective dementia care. Aliviado Teams with Home Health Providers to Slash Dementia-Related Readmissions

Roughly one out of every three patients receiving home health care services has some form of dementia. The numbers are similar, though slightly smaller, for hospice. Despite this prevalence, many home-based caregivers lack the training and educational expertise to provide care that’s truly effective.
